| Exterior | The Ekolot TOPAZ is a modern high-wing aircraft featuring a sleek cantilever wing design without external struts, resulting in improved aerodynamic efficiency, higher cruise speeds and a very clean appearance. The aircraft is constructed using advanced composite technology with carbon and fiberglass structural elements, combining low weight, high strength and excellent durability.
The spacious side-by-side cockpit design offers excellent visibility and pilot comfort, while the aerodynamic fuselage and carefully refined airframe provide outstanding cross-country performance and efficiency. The TOPAZ is widely recognized for its elegant lines, modern styling and excellent handling characteristics.

| Modifications/Conversions | The aircraft has been professionally converted to the SW (Short Wings) configuration by the aircraft manufacturer.
As part of this modification, the original wingspan was reduced from 11.5 m to 10.5 m, resulting in lower aerodynamic drag and improved cruise performance. The SW version offers higher cruise speeds while maintaining the excellent handling characteristics for which the TOPAZ is known.
The conversion was carried out directly by Ekolot, ensuring full compliance with the manufacturer's specifications and maintaining the highest standards of workmanship and airworthiness. |
